Kutheni Abathengi be-B2B Betshintshela kwiintambo ze-Aluminium: Iingenelo, iiNgozi kunye neengozi ezifihlakeleyo

I-Copper ibisoloko iyindlela eqhelekileyo yokunxibelelana ngentambo kurhwebo nakwimizi-mveliso, kodwa amaqela okuthenga acinga ngokutsha ngaloo ndlela njengoko uhlahlo-lwabiwo mali lwezinto eziphathekayo luqina kwaye amaxabiso eemveliso etshintsha. Kwiinkampani ze-EPC, iinkonzo zikawonke-wonke, kunye nabanini bezakhiwo ezinkulu, intambo ye-aluminium inika umxube onomtsalane wexabiso eliphantsi kunye nobunzima obuphantsi, kudla ngokwenza kube lula ukubiza, ukuthumela, kunye nokufaka iipakeji zombane ezinomthamo omkhulu. Sekunjalo isigqibo asilula njengokutshintshiselana ngesinyithi esinye ngesinye. I-aluminium ifuna ingqalelo enzulu kuhlobo lwe-alloy, ubungakanani be-ampacity, indawo ye-conduit, ukuphela, kunye neendleko ezifakiweyo. Eli nqaku lihlola apho intambo ye-aluminium idala khona ixabiso lokwenyani le-B2B—kwaye apho iingozi ezifihlakeleyo zinokutshabalalisa khona ukonga okulindelekileyo.

Kutheni Abathengi be-B2B bekhetha ikhebula le-aluminium

Kwiminyaka elishumi edlulileyo, kubekho utshintsho olukhulu kwindlela amaqela okuthenga ajongana ngayo neziseko zophuhliso zombane. Nangona ithusi ibisoloko ilawula iziseko zophuhliso zombane. imakethi yentambo yorhwebo neyemizi-mveliso, Abathengi be-B2B baya betshintshela ngakumbi kwezinye iindlela ze-aluminium. Olu tshintsho aluyonto nje edlulayo; licebo elicwangcisiweyo lokulinganisela uhlahlo-lwabiwo mali oluqinileyo lweziseko zophuhliso kunye namaxesha eeprojekthi anzima. Olu tshintsho lubonakala kakhulu kwiinkampani zobuNjineli, ukuThenga, kunye noKwakha (EPC) kunye nabaphuhlisi beenkonzo zombane abalawula iindleko ezinkulu zezinto zokwakha.

Iziseko zeCable zeAluminiyam

Eyona nto iphambili kuyo, i-aluminium yombane yanamhlanje yahlukile kwizinto ezazibangela iingozi zomlilo ezidumileyo ngeminyaka yoo-1960 noo-1970. Namhlanje, ucingo lwezakhiwo zorhwebo luxhomekeke kakhulu kwi-aluminium alloy ye-8000 series (AA-8000), ephucukileyo kakhulu amandla okutsalwa, ukuguquguquka, kunye nokuzinza kobushushu. (Kubalulekile ukuqaphela ukuba amagama aqhelekileyo afana ne-XHHW-2 kunye ne-THHN/THWN-2 zii-insulation kunye nokulinganiswa kobushushu okusebenzayo kuzo zombini ii-copper kunye ne-aluminium conductors, kungekhona iintlobo ze-aluminium-specific wire.) Ngenxa yokuba ezinye ii-aluminium alloys zisebenza ngezicelo ezahlukeneyo ezikhethekileyo, abathengi kufuneka balumke ukuba bangazigqithisi iinkcukacha zezinto ezibonakalayo. Kwi-conductor ephezulu, elingana ne-ampacity, i- Intambo ye-aluminiyam ye-AA-8000 inobunzima obungaphantsi ngama-30% ukuya kuma-50% kunobo bentsimbi, kuxhomekeke kwigeyiji echanekileyo kunye neenkcukacha zobushushu. Oku kunciphisa ubunzima kakhulu kwenza okungaphezulu kokunciphisa iindleko zokuthutha kunye nokuhambisa; kwenza ukuphathwa ngokomzimba, ukutsala i-conduit, kunye nokubeka izinto ngexesha lokufakelwa kube lula kwaye kukhuseleke kakhulu kubakhi.

Ixabiso, Ukuguquguquka kweCopper, kunye neSikali seProjekthi

Nangona kunjalo, eyona nto iphambili kule nguqu yemarike, luqoqosho. Amaxabiso ethusi ayaziwa ngokuguquguquka, ehlala enyuka kutshintshiselwano lweempahla zehlabathi ngenxa yeemfuno zokwenziwa kwe-EV. Nangona amaxabiso e-aluminium nawo etshintshatshintsha, isinyithi sibonelela ngexabiso eliphantsi kakhulu, elihlala likhokelela ekongeni iindleko zezinto eziphathekayo ukusuka kuma-40% ukuya kuma-50% ii-odolo ezinkulu zekhebulaNangona kunjalo, abathengi kufuneka baqaphele ukuba la manani amalunga nomlinganiselo oqikelelweyo oxhomekeke kakhulu kwiindlela zokusasazwa kwezinto zexesha langempela, igeyiji echanekileyo, kunye neenkcukacha zokufakelwa kwe-insulation.

Ngaphezu koko, iindleko ezifakiweyo zinokwahluka; iimfuno ze-conduit enkulu, izixhobo ezikhethekileyo zokuphelisa, kunye nomsebenzi owongezelelweyo zinokunciphisa ezinye zezi zinto zokonga izinto zokuqala. I-aluminium ngokubanzi ayisebenzi okanye ayisebenzi kwiisekethe zesebe ezincinci (umz., i-12 AWG nangaphantsi), kwaye ukonga izinto kunciphisa kwiiodolo ezincinci, nto leyo ethintela inkuthazo yemali yokutshintshela kwiiprojekthi zorhwebo ezincinci. Nangona kunjalo, kwizibonelelo zesikali se-megawatt, ezi zonga zisaqhubeka ngokukhawuleza zibe zizigidi zeerandi. Ucingo lokwakha i-aluminium eqhelekileyo lufumaneka rhoqo ngabasasazi ngaphandle kwezibopho ezinkulu zomthamo ngqo kumzi-mveliso, nto leyo eyenza ukuba ifikeleleke kwaye ibe nexabiso elifanelekileyo kwiindidi ezahlukeneyo zobungakanani beprojekthi.

Iingenelo, iiNgozi kunye neengozi zeAluminium Cable

Iingenelo, iiNgozi kunye neengozi zeAluminium Cable

Nangona kukho izibonelelo zemali ezicacileyo, ukutshintsha izinto akuyondlela ilula yokutshintsha umntu ngamnye. Amaqela okuthenga kunye nobunjineli kufuneka ahlolisise ngononophelo urhwebo, imiqathango ebonakalayo, kunye neengozi zokufakelwa ngaphambi kokuba azibophelele kwi-aluminium kwiprojekthi enkulu yorhwebo.

Endaweni yokujonga i-aluminium njengento ethatha indawo yayo yonke indawo, abathengi kufuneka bahlole impembelelo ebanzi yeempawu zezinto ezisetyenzisiweyo. Iingenelo eziphambili—iindleko eziphantsi kakhulu zesiseko kunye nobunzima obuphantsi—kufuneka zilinganiswe neenyani ezibonakalayo zee-conduits ezinkulu, iimfuno ezikhulayo zendawo kumagumbi ombane, kunye neenkqubo ezingqongqo zokufakela ezifunekayo ukuthintela ukungaphumeleli kokuphela. Ngenxa yokuba i-aluminium ngokubanzi ayisebenzi kwiisekethe zesebe ezincinci, iiprojekthi zihlala zifuna indlela exutyiweyo, esebenzisa i-aluminium yezinto zokondla ezinzima kunye nobhedu kumasebe amancinci.

Izinto Zokusebenza Ekufanele Zithelekiswe

Eyona nto ibalulekileyo yobunjineli ekufuneka ivavanywe kukukwazi umbane. I-Aluminiyam ine-61% kuphela yokukwazi umbane okunamandla kobhedu. Ukuze umbane ofanayo ngokukhuselekileyo uthwale ngokukhuselekileyo, intambo ye-aluminiyam kufuneka inyuswe ngobukhulu obunye okanye obubini be-American Wire Gauge (AWG). Le nyani ebonakalayo ithetha ukuba kufuneka ii-conduits ezinkulu, i-radii egobileyo, kunye nesithuba esingaphezulu somzimba kumagumbi ombane. Apha ngezantsi kukho uthelekiso olusisiseko olusetyenziselwa ukuvavanya ezi zinto ngexesha lesigaba sokuqala soyilo:

Uphawu I-aluminium Alloy ye-8000 Series Ubhedu oluqhelekileyo
Ukuqhuba kweVolumetric okuHlanganisiweyo 61% 100%
Ubunzima (Ubungakanani obulinganayo) ~30-50% ekhaphukhaphu Isiseko
Iindleko zeZinto eziThe ngqo ~40-50% isezantsi Phezulu / Ukuguquguquka kakhulu
I-Wire Gauge efunekayo Ubukhulu obu-1-2 obukhulu Umgangatho

Xa kucaciswa ezi zinto zezakhiwo ezinkulu zorhwebo okanye zoshishino, ukuvavanya ezi miqathango yobukhulu obubonakalayo ngokuchasene neemeko zendawo kubalulekile ukuqinisekisa ukusebenza kwexesha elide kunye nokuthotyelwa kwemithetho.

Iingozi zokuthobela imithetho kunye nokufakelwa

Iingozi ezifihlakeleyo ze-aluminium zivela kakhulu kwiindlela ezimbi zokufakela endaweni yeziphene ezikhoyo kwizinto ngokwazo. I-aluminium inomlinganiselo ophezulu kakhulu wokwanda kobushushu kune-copper, oko kuthetha ukuba iyakhula kwaye iyancipha kakhulu phantsi kwemithwalo enzima yobushushu. Ikwachaphazeleka yinto eyaziwa ngokuba yi-"cold flow" okanye i-creep, apho isinyithi sitshintsha kancinci phantsi koxinzelelo oluqhubekayo loomatshini kwiindawo zokuphela. Ngaphezu koko, ukudibanisa i-aluminium ngokuthe ngqo ne-copper kwandisa kakhulu umngcipheko we-galvanic corrosion ukuba iindlela ezilungileyo ze-National Electrical Code (NEC) azinakwa.

Ukuze kuncitshiswe le mingcipheko, abafaki kufuneka basebenzise ii-aluminium conductors ze-wire-brush ngaphambi kokuba zicinywe, basebenzise ii-oxide-inhibiting compounds, basebenzise ii-dual-rated (AL/CU) lugs ezifanelekileyo, kwaye balandele ulandelelwano oluchanekileyo lwe-torque. Amaqela kufuneka aqwalasele nokugcinwa komjikelo wobomi. Ngelixa isikhokelo sembali sicebisa ukuba ukupheliswa kwe-aluminium kufuna ukuphinda kutshintshwe rhoqo emva kweminyaka efakiweyo, i-alloy yanamhlanje ye-AA-8000 efakwe kunye nezihlanganisi ze-AL/CU ezitshintshwe ngokufanelekileyo zenza oku kube yinto ephelelwe lixesha. Endaweni yoko, into ebalulekileyo kukufakelwa kokuqala ngokuchanekileyo ngokweenkcukacha ze-torque zomenzi, kulandele ukuqinisekiswa emva kokufakwa kunye nokuhlolwa okucwangcisiweyo. Okubaluleke kakhulu, ukuhambelana kwe-aluminium kudlulela ngaphaya kwee-lugs kuphela; iiphaneli, ii-breakers, kunye neebha zebhasi nazo kufuneka zilinganiswe ngokucacileyo kwi-aluminium, ukuqinisekisa ukuthotyelwa kweekhowudi ezifana ne-NEC Article 110.14. Ukusilela okuninzi kwentsimi kudla ngokubangelwa kukungafakwa kwala manyathelo abalulekileyo okufakela.

Indlela yokufumana intambo ye-aluminiyam ngokukhuselekileyo

Ngenxa yokuba umda wempazamo ngexesha lokufakwa kunye nokupheliswa umncinci, ukufumana intambo ye-aluminiyam ekumgangatho ophezulu kwaye ukuphonononga ababoneleli ngokupheleleyo kuyimfuneko engenakuphikiswana ngayo kumaqela okuthenga. Abathengi abanakukwazi ukuyekelela umgangatho xa ukuthembeka kwegridi kusemngciphekweni.

Ukuqinisekiswa kunye neMigangatho yabaThengi

Xa kuphicothwa amaqabane anokuba ngabavelisi, abathengi kufuneka bajonge ukuthotyelwa okungqongqo nokubhaliweyo kwimigangatho yokhuseleko lwamazwe ngamazwe kunye neyokuvelisa.

Izinto ezibalulekileyo ekufuneka ziqwalaselwe

  • Sebenzisa i-aluminium alloy ye-AA-8000 kwizicelo zanamhlanje zentambo yesakhiwo sorhwebo endaweni yokucinga ukuba zonke ii-conductor ze-aluminium zineempawu ezifanayo zokusebenza.
  • Thelekisa iindleko ezifakiweyo kuba ukonga izinto ezingama-40% ukuya kuma-50% kunokunciphisa nge-conduit enkulu, iziphelo ezikhethekileyo, izixhobo, kunye nomsebenzi owongezelelweyo.
  • Isicwangciso see-conductors ezinkulu kuba intambo ye-aluminiyam elingana ne-ampacity inkulu kune-copper nangona inobunzima obungaphantsi ngama-30% ukuya kuma-50%.
  • Beka phambili intambo ye-aluminiyam kwiiprojekthi ezinkulu zorhwebo, zoshishino, ze-EPC, kunye nezoncedo apho ukuthenga ngobuninzi kunokuguqula ukonga kweempahla kube kukunciphisa okukhulu kwebhajethi.
  • Kuphephe ukusebenzisa i-aluminium njengento elula yokutshintsha ubhedu, kwaye uqinisekise ukuba i-connector iyahambelana, iimfuno ze-torque, kunye neenkqubo zokufakela ngaphambi kokuba uthenge.

Imibuzo ebuzwa qho

Kutheni abathengi be-B2B bekhetha intambo ye-aluminiyam kuneyobhedu?

Uninzi lwabathengi lutshintshela kulawulo lweendleko. Intambo ye-aluminiyam inokunciphisa iindleko zezinto ezithe ngqo malunga ne-40% ukuya kwi-50% kwiiodolo ezinkulu, ngelixa ubunzima bayo obuphantsi bunokunciphisa iindleko zokuthutha kwaye kwenze kube lula ukuphatha ukufakwa.

Ngaba intambo ye-aluminiyam yanamhlanje iyafana nentambo ye-aluminiyam esetyenziswa kumakhaya amadala?

Hayi. Ucingo lwesakhiwo se-aluminium yorhwebo lwanamhlanje ludla ngokusebenzisa i-AA-8000 series alloy, ephucule amandla, ukuguquguquka, kunye nokuzinza kobushushu xa kuthelekiswa nocingo lwe-aluminium endala olunxulumene nemiba yokhuseleko lwezindlu zangaphambili.

Yeyiphi ingozi efihlakeleyo xa utshintshela kwintambo ye-aluminiyam?

Eyona ngozi inkulu kukuphatha i-aluminium njengotshintsho lobhedu ngqo. I-aluminium idla ngokufuna ubungakanani obukhulu bomqhubi, ii-lugs ezihambelanayo, i-torque echanekileyo, iindlela ezifanelekileyo zokulwa ne-oxidation, kunye novavanyo lobunjineli olucokisekileyo ukuze kuthintelwe ukugqithisa okanye ukungaphumeleli kokuphelisa.

Ngaba intambo ye-aluminiyam ihlala inciphisa iindleko zeprojekthi iyonke?

Akunjalo rhoqo. Ukonga izinto eziphathekayo kunokulinganiswa yi-conduit enkulu, izihlanganisi ezahlukeneyo, iziphelo ezikhethekileyo, okanye abasebenzi abongezelelweyo. Abathengi kufuneka bathelekise iindleko ezifakiweyo zizonke, kungekuphela nje ixabiso lokuthenga ikhebula.

Kuphi apho intambo ye-aluminiyam ingabizi kakhulu?

Intambo ye-aluminiyam idla ngokuba yeyona inomtsalane kwiiprojekthi ezinkulu zorhwebo, zoshishino, zezixhobo, kunye neze-EPC apho ukusebenza ixesha elide kunye nobuninzi bezinto ezibonakalayo kwenza ukonga kube luncedo.
